The Global Platform for Sustainable Naural Rubber is an international, multi-stakeholder, voluntary membership initiative committed to improving the socioeconomics and environmental performance of the natural rubber value chain.  Development of the GPSNR was intiated by the CEOs of the World Business Council for Sustainable Development (WBCSD) Tire Industry Project (TIP) in 2018.  Members of the platform include tire manufacturers, rubber suppliers and processors, vehicle makers and NGOs.  Representatives from each of these stakeholder groups have contributed to the development of the Singapore-based platform and the wide-reaching set of priorities that will define strategy and objectives.

The GPSNR aims to support the natural rubber sector to become more sustainable. Key element in achieving  this is to ensure there is capacity among smallholders and industrial plantations to adopt best practices in NR  production.

2. Objectives and Scope of Work     

There are approximately 2.25M smallholders in Indonesia, representing 83% of national natural rubber production (3.6 M tonnes). Smallholders cultivate less than 2 ha of land with an average yield of slightly below 1 ton/ha, as compared to state and private commercial plantations achieving 1.4 ton/ha and 1.5 ton/ha respectively. 

Indonesia’s average rubber yield is significantly lower than neighbouring countries in Southeast Asia; such low yield is due to low-quality clones, limited knowledge of Good Agricultural Practices (GAP) and aging trees.

Most rubber trees in Indonesia were planted from 1978-1991 through several government schemes. Given that rubber trees only have a 25-year productive lifespan, with steeply declining yields thereafter, almost all rubber trees planted under these schemes have passed their peak production. Whilst there is no formal data available on tree aging in Indonesia, the Ministry of Agriculture estimates around 600,000 – 700,000 ha of natural rubber plantations need rejuvenation. Replanting should ideally occur on about 4% of plantations annually to ensure a stable output. Yet, it is estimated that between 2010 and 2017 replanting of only 1.3% was undertaken. 

Using the right clone makes a tremendous difference in a rubber tree’s lifetime yields. The productivity of rubber clonal and seedling-derived plants is almost 3 x lower than for certified clones. Across the region, only 5% of farmers received their seedlings through a government programme. Certified nurseries are only located in provincial and district capital cities resulting in limited access to high-yielding planting materials for remote smallholders.

Additionally, poor tapping techniques are another major cause of low yields and can decrease the productive life of trees by up to 50%. It is estimated that an average smallholder with 1.5 ha of rubber will earn 57% less than the Indonesian minimum wage.  

Five provinces contribute 66.5% of national production: South Sumatra, North Sumatra, Jambi, Riau, and West Kalimantan. South Sumatra province is Indonesia’s largest and most productive area. Its natural rubber area is almost 23% of the total national productive area and smallholders’ plantations take up 98.5% of this area. The productivity of smallholders in South Sumatra is the highest among smallholder areas in Indonesia, producing 1.3 ton/ha, and more likely to have received GAP training. In 2019 the government announced a replanting plan for 2019 – 2027, with a focus on South Sumatra (92,600 ha), South Kalimantan (76,550 ha) and Jambi (69,900 ha). However, this plan has no large-scale lending programme associated with it and is to be executed by local governments and has not yet been implemented. Demand for replanting is strongest in Jambi, where 40% of farmers are willing to undertake replanting. Demand is lowest in West Kalimantan, where only 1 farmer out of 79 was contemplating. Most likely the demand in Jambi is due to peak planting being undertaken in 1995 – 2005 and the majority of the trees are approaching their maximum productive age, and Jambi farmers are more aware of the importance of good quality clones and their impact on yield – they also have the highest rate of nursery clone purchase – and have suffered less from disease.

Annex A: Deforestation

Gaps that the group has identified in the Risk Analysis Working Document:

  • Is it possible, and if so how, to assess this risk at a coarse grain country or province / district level, or does such an assessment have to be done at the landscape / plantation level?  
    -Which tools (e.g., publicly or commercially available HCV/HCS maps exist for which rubber growing areas? 
    -How do these existing maps need to be queried and what answers can they provide to members?  
    -Should existing tools not be sufficient, what tools would need to be developed to assess risk at a satisfactory level, sufficient to protect HCVs and HCS forests?  

  • What is the likelihood of existing, known smallholders to expand into HCV/HCS?  
    -Is there a link to the distance between current plantations and blocks of HCV/HCS?  
    -Is there a link between the occurrence of fire hotspots, rubber plantations and blocks of HCV/HCS? 
    -If there is, what intensity of fire hotspots can indicate what levels of risk to HCV/HCS? 
    -What level of detail do maps have to have to identify such a link with reasonable accuracy? 
    -What is the likelihood of previously unknown smallholders to open forest for new plantations? 
    -What are the early warning signs for either? How can they be detected, analysed, and applied? 
    -At what time will it be necessary to conduct detailed plantation level surveys?  

  • At what risk threshold should downstream buyers engage in on-site surveys and risk mitigation activities? 
    -Can such threshold be quantified or at least categorized into no/low versus high risk, and if so, how? 
    -What tools exist for such on-site activities and who can apply them?  
    -How can the impact of such risk mitigation activities be evaluated?  
    -At what threshold should buyers refrain from buying supplies from the assessed area?
